Pomoc - Szukaj - Użytkownicy - Kalendarz
Pełna wersja: Tworzenie tabel za pomocą tekstu :)
Forum PHP.pl > Inne > Hydepark
slawo123
Witam, chciałbym na pewnym forum opartym o phpbb2 zaprezentować tabelę zawierającą dużo wierszy. Po skopiowaniu danych z tabeli umieszczonej na stronie html powstaje mi takie coś:
Kod
1.    User   19    3    6
   2.    Pehapowiec    19    3    6
   3.    Usr2    20    3    7


A mi by się marzyło pokazanie tego w ten sposób jak przykładowa struktura tabeli z bazy:
Kod
+---+-----------+--------+-----------+----------+
  |ID | OBJECT_ID | ATR_ID | ATR_NAME  | ATR_TYPE |
  +---+-----------+--------+-----------+----------+
  | 1 |    10     |   1    | atrybut 1 |    1     |
  | 2 |    10     |   5    | atrybut 2 |    1     |
  | 3 |    10     |   3    | atrybut 8 |    1     |
  | 4 |    10     |   15   | atrybut 4 |    3     |
  | 5 |    10     |   8    | atrybut 5 |    2     |
  | 6 |    02     |   21   | atrybut 7 |    2     |
  +---+-----------+--------+-----------+----------+


W jaki sposób uzyskujecie taki zrzut struktury mysql jak wyżej i czy mógłbym podobnie to wykonać w skrypcie php generującym taką tabelę
Shadowsword
Po pierwsze to chyba nie ten dział winksmiley.jpg

Taki zrzut uzyskuje się za pomocą zapytania select, tylko do tego musisz mieć treści w bazie danych, a nie w tabelce.

Nie możesz zrobić printscreena strony i wrzucić, albo podać link? Będzie 100 razy łatwiej, bo jedyne rozwiązanie jakie mi przychodzi do głowy to albo ręcznie poprawiać, albo napisać własny program, który to zamieni co zajmnie jeszcze więcej czasu. Nie zapomniaj, że zazwyczaj masz limit dlugości posta, więc jeśli jest tego naprawdę dużo to będziesz musiał to rozbić na kilka, kilkanaście albo nawet kilkadziesiąt postów.
wookieb
Jeżeli dodasz do swojego parsera bbcode odpowiedni tag w którym wrzucasz to co masz w pierwszym boxie to może on ci zamienić tabulatory na odpowiednie kreski itd.

O ile dobrze pamiętam taki "ładny" wynik otrzymuje się przy wykonywania zapytania SELECT z poziomu konsoli.
To jest wersja lo-fi głównej zawartości. Aby zobaczyć pełną wersję z większą zawartością, obrazkami i formatowaniem proszę kliknij tutaj.
Invision Power Board © 2001-2025 Invision Power Services, Inc.